LAV-600
Any of you guys play one of these...?? I'm not even sure how I got this thing because I am strictly a tracks guy. At any rate, I have had the LAV-600 in reserve since I got it, but yesterday day I decided to dust it off and play a couple of matches.
I have mixed feelings about it.... On the one hand it has a powerful gun with an excellent 105mm HEAT shell, the turret traverse is very quick after upgrades, plus I have the reload time down to 5.4 secs, and the armor is not bad for a "wheely" thing.

On the flip side, I was always under the impression that one of the main strengths of these wheely things was their high speed and maneuverability. Oddly enough this thing seems a tad sluggish to despite it's "on paper" top speed and acceleration, but the really surprising thing for me is it's turning ability, it really seems lacking to me in this department, and I always thought these wheely's were supposed to be able to turn on a dime. Anyway, i'll play it some more before I make a decision, but I may end up putting it back in reserve, or sell it outright.

Are there any other wheely's at Tier 6 and below that would have decent armor and armament, and race car maneuverability...??

To be honest, I think the atrocious turning speed is a bug. Like how slowly the ASCOD goes in reverse, it's so exaggeratedly slow that it feels like a bug.

Anyways, I hated the Lav-TDs until I got the improved reduction drive from the Mephisto unlocked. It helps tremendously, sure it takes a retrofit slot, but it's cheap and I find it makes the vehicle much more comfortable to play.

The Lavs are excellent to scoot and shoot from behind hard cover and they can pen everything.

Still, I hate cannon TDs and I don't play them aside from climbing the tree but they weren't a nightmare to grind through.
